#74c271 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#74c271 is composed of 45.5% red, 76.1%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.8%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 117.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.9% and a lightness of 60.2%. #74c271 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ffe2 with #008500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#74c271 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.

#74c271 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#74c271 has RGB values of R:116, G:194,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 7651953.

Shades and Tints of #74c271

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040904 is the darkest color, while #fafd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#74c271

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989b98 is the less saturated color, while #41f93a is the most saturated one.
